Kimtech™ G3 white nitrile ambidextrous gloves deliver enhanced contamination protection and tactile performance in sensitive applications. The powder-free gloves are static dissipative and feature a high grip for delicate, non sterile processes.

Kimtech™ G3 white nitrile gloves are ideal for handling delicate equipment in microelectronics, semiconductor, optics, and non sterile pharmaceutical applications. Designed for use when the highest levels of sensitivity, protection, and performance are required. The high-quality nitrile gloves deliver seamless protection when and where it is needed and are suitable for ISO class 3 or higher cleanroom environments.
The nitrile polymer material is designed for fit and reliability, with textured fingertips for improved grip and excellent water tightness with a low risk of pinholes. The gloves are ambidextrous and incorporate a beaded cuff for added strength and ease of donning, so the wearer can simply grab and go without any fear of ripping the material. The non sterile nitrile safety gloves are also latex-free, silicone-free, and powder-free.
The absence of natural rubber latex reduces the risk of TYPE 1 glove-associated reactions, protecting the wearer as well as the application, and the gloves are static dissipative in use making them suitable for sensitive processes and components. During manufacture the gloves are washed repeatedly in ultra-pure deionised water to ensure consistent control of particles and extractables. The gloves are designated as PPE Cat III according to (EU) Regulation 2016/425 and are provided double-bagged in cleanroom-compatible polyethylene and case liner.
Certifikat: PPE Cat III according to regulation (EU) 2016/425. EN ISO 374-1:2016 Type B (KPT) chemical splash protection. EN 374-4:2003 resistance to degradation by chemicals. EN ISO 374-5:2016 micro organism and VIRUS protection.
